Hundreds of windowpanes in the gazebo-shaped solarium in front of this engaging Victorian B&B yield views onto the tranquil lake that gives Spring Lake its name and a glimpse of the ocean a block away.

The eye-catching atrium-style solarium is the site of an extravagant breakfast served by owners Joanie and Bill Mahon. “You couldn't face a better way to start the day,” says Bill. The fare includes fresh fruit compote, cereal, banana-nut bread and perhaps waffles or a crêpe dish.

The Mahons returned to the Jersey Shore, where he grew up, to take over what Travel & Leisure magazine cited as the B&B of choice in the storybook town of Spring Lake. “I’d been on a Christmas tour here and saw this house,” said Joanie. “It was so different and charming. Little did I know I’d end up living here.” Its laid-back Victorian character and its central location close to lake, ocean and village shops and restaurants sealed the deal.

With an eye toward guests’ comfort, the Mahons undertook two months of renovations and refurbishing to the 1877 house. They refinished the original floors, redecorated the rooms and lightened up the decor in what Bill calls “fresh beach style.” Two guest rooms yield views of the water and two have fireplaces. Ten hold queensize beds and one has a king. Updated bathrooms, ceiling fans and air conditioning are standard. Room 4 on the third floor, up in the treetops with a view of the lake, is a guest favorite. Most in demand in summer is a rear first-floor room with a private porch.

Common areas include a living room with fireplace and a large-screen TV/VCR. Guests enjoy wicker rockers and loveseats on the airy front porch shaded by century-old sentinel sycamores and cooled by sea breezes.

The Mahons serve complimentary beverages including coffee, iced tea, soft drinks and bottled water. They offer bicycles for touring the area, as well as guest privileges at the Atlantic Club health and fitness center. Beach passes, beach equipment and an outdoor shower for returning beach-goers are other amenities. They led New Jersey Life magazine to select Ashling Cottage as "one of the top six beach houses in New Jersey ."
